Artisans Beyond Borders (ABB) is a binational not-for-profit formed in 2019 to bring restorative trauma-informed arts and activities to asylum-seekers waiting in shelters and on the streets in Nogales, Sonora, Mexico. ABB continues to lift up and preserve cultural arts and the dignity of work for families stranded at the border or now legally in the U.S., awaiting asylum adjudication. Donations and grants to www.ArtisansBeyondBorders.org Maker’s Fund keep this vital programming going and also support developing artisan enterprises. “Bordando Esperanza/Embroidering Hope,” a group exhibition of original hand-stitched prayer and memory, gives us the opportunity to see and feel what is true and sacred from the hands of the women and men living it.
